Subtract one column value to each column values in same row

1000039893.jpg

 Hi All,

As per my business requirements I have to subtract current year (actual) column values to all the other column(MAR_FCST,PLAN, ACTUAL (2023)) values as shown in the matrix visuals. I am able to that for current year means current year actual column value I am able to subtract from current year mar_fcst, and plan and Actual. But not able to subtract current year actual column value to previous year actual column value.

I am getting correct results in the GTN% GS~ 

For year 2024 columns.

Explanation is below:

I want to subtract 2024 ACTUAL column value which is 43.8% to other column that is 

(43.8-43.8) for plan and (42.8-43.8) for mar-fcst and (42.7-43.8) for plan and (40.9-43.8) for 2023 actual. But I am not able to do that for 2023.

Hi @ShyamS 

 

Given that I don't understand the structure of your specific data, I can only give you some suggestions that might be useful:

Maybe you can change your measure into this:

GTN % GS ~ =
VAR A = [GTN % GS]
VAR CurrentDate =
    MAX ( CV_GMR_PL_APAC_REPORT[Year] )
VAR B =
    CALCULATE (
        [GTN % GS],
        CV_GMR_PL_APAC_REPORTING[Year] = YEAR ( CurrenDate ),
        CV_GMR_PL_APAC_REPORTING[Scenario] = "ACTUAL"
    )
VAR C = ( ( A - B ) * 10000 )
RETURN
    C
